Dividends are declared by the board of directors of a company.
Dividends are typically declared by the board of directors of a company.
The board of directors considers various factors such as company performance, financial health, and future growth prospects before declaring dividends.
Shareholders receive dividends as a distribution of profits.
Dividends can be in the form of cash, stock, or property.

Shares represent ownership in a company and entitle the holder to a portion of the company's assets and profits.
Shares are units of ownership in a company that are bought and sold on the stock market.
Shareholders have voting rights and may receive dividends based on the company's performance.
Shares can be classified as common stock or preferred stock, each with different rights and benefits.

Working capital is the difference between current assets and current liabilities.
Working capital is the amount of money a company has available to fund its day-to-day operations.
It is calculated by subtracting current liabilities from current assets.
Current assets include cash, inventory, and accounts receivable, while current liabilities include accounts payable and short-term debt.

Net worth of a company is calculated by subtracting its total liabilities from its total assets.
Calculate the total assets of the company, including cash, investments, property, and equipment.
Calculate the total liabilities of the company, including debts, loans, and other financial obligations.
Subtract the total liabilities from the total assets to get the net worth of the company.

Transactions and activities are recorded in cash flow statements to show the inflow and outflow of cash.
Cash flow statements show the sources and uses of cash during a specific period.
Transactions that increase cash are recorded as inflows, while those that decrease cash are recorded as outflows.
Activities that affect cash flow include operating, investing, and financing activities.
